This review is from: Thermos Scooby Doo Mystery Lunch Kit
My 5 year old is ready for kindergarten with his new Mystery Machine lunch kit. Our kit does include the sandwich container which is designed apparently for Smucker's Uncrustable's. I like the coin container on the front of the van - perfect for milk money, although there is a water bottle included. The water bottle won't roll around as there is a velcro strap to keep it in place. The lunch box opens at the roof with 2 zippers across the top and an additional velcro fasten to secure it. While this lunch kit was a bit pricier than others, I found it to be unique and it certainly put a big smile on my Scooby fan's face!

This review is from: Thermos Scooby Doo Mystery Lunch Kit
This is so cute. It keeps my daughters food nice a cold. it is the perfect size for a Kindergartners lunch. If you are buying this for a bigger lunch it might be a little on the small side after putting the icepack in or a bottle of water. It is easy to carry and the little pocket up front is perfect for milk money or cookie money for lunch time.
